Colonic temperature and body weight in the nonacclimated group and the acclimated groups in absence and presence of acriflavine

Days
Weeks
Group Basal 2 3 1 2 3 4
Tc, °C
    C 36.8 ± 0.1 37.3 ± 0.09 36.8 ± 0.04 37.2 ± 0.04 36.7 ± 0.09 36.6 ± 0.05 36.7 ± 0.06
    C-ACF30 36.9 ± 01 37.2 ± 0.1 36.9 ± 0.09 37 ± 0.1 36.6 ± 0.08 36.7 ± 0.08 36.6 ± 0.08
    $HA 37 ± 0.1 38 ± 0.1 37.5 ± 0.09 37.7±.08* 38 ± 0.1* 38 ± 0.1* 38 ± 0.1*
    &HA-ACF30 37 ± 0.13 37.6 ± 0.1 38.2 ± 0.1 37.7 ± 0.07 37.5 ± 0.08 38.1 ± 0.1 38.1 ± 0.1
Body weight %change, g
    C 87.0 ± 1.6 103.0 ± 3.6 107.7 ± 2.7 133.0 ± 1.4 158.0 ± 5.3 218.9 ± 4.3 308.3 ± 4.0
    C-ACF30 86.4 ± 1.2 103.0 ± 1.3 107.8 ± 0.9 135.0 ± 1.6 159.6 ± 3.5 220.7 ± 4.7 310.5 ± 5.0
    $HA 94.3 ± 2.1 111.0 ± 2.2 117.9 ± 2.6 127.1 ± 2.7 163.7 ± 2.9 207.0 ± 2.2* 246.7 ± 2.0*
    &HA-CF30 89.0 ± 3.0 101.9 ± 1.2 104.5 ± 2.8 129.2 ± 4.7 161.4 ± 5.8 199.2 ± 7.2 215.0 ± 6.8

Data are presented as means ± SE; n = 5. Tc, colonic temperature; HA, heat acclimated; C, nonacclimated; ACF, acriflavine. C-ACF, control ACF; ACF30, ACF administered for 30 days.
